SMCM Join Local HS Students for Orchestra Performance Nov. 23
ST. MARY'S COUNTY - 11/20/2008
|
The St. Mary’s College of Maryland Orchestra, along with 50 music students from Chopticon, Leonardtown, and Great Mills high schools, will perform Bruckner Symphony No. 4, Mozart Serenade No. 12 for Winds and Ewazen Western Fanfare on Sunday, Nov. 23, at 3 p.m. in the Athletic and Recreation Center Arena. |
